A GOLD COAST ICON
Experience Gold Coast’s Timeless Emblem Welcome to The Mansion at Glen Cove
Built in 1910, this 55-acre Georgian estate was the cherished home of John Teele Pratt and Ruth Baker Pratt, New York’s first congresswoman. Designed by the renowned Charles Platt, its grandeur earned a place among America’s finest country homes. In time, its halls echoed with history as it became the summer White House for President Herbert Hoover.
Now reimagined as The Mansion at Glen Cove, this opulent retreat offers 185 elegant guest rooms, over 25,000 square feet of event space, and breathtaking gardens for unforgettable gatherings.
